The government aims to update the $6 a year license for concessionaires of radio and television frequencies which has been in effect since 1954, while employers fear a reallocation of spectrum.
The draft bill proposes an increase in the rates for radio and television based on the number of frequencies held by the concessionaire, the type of coverage, the use to be given and the type of diffusion, national or rural.
Up until December 26th public consultation will be carried out on the national telecommunications plan 2015-2021 proposed by the Ministry of Science, Technology and Telecommunications.
